The Evolution of Robotic Vacuums
The concept of a robotic vacuum cleaner go back to the late 20th century, but it wasn't up until the early 2000s that these devices ended up being commercially practical. The first commonly recognized robotic vacuum, the iRobot Roomba, was introduced in 2002. Robotic vacuums operate utilizing a combination of sensing units, algorithms, and motors. Here's a breakdown of the essential components and processes:
Sensors: These consist of infrared, ultrasonic, and optical sensors that assist the vacuum discover barriers, edges, and dirt. Some designs likewise utilize electronic cameras for visual mapping.Mapping and Navigation: Advanced models utilize S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) technology to produce a map of the cleaning location and browse effectively.Suction and Brushes: Robotic vacuums utilize effective motors to develop suction and different brushes to select up dirt and debris. Some designs consist of side brushes to reach into corners.Battery and Charging: Most robotic vacuums are geared up with rechargeable lithium-ion batteries. Q: Are robotic vacuums as efficient as standard vacuums?A: While they may not be as effective as high-end conventional vacuums, modern robotic vacuums are extremely effective for routine cleaning jobs. They are especially useful for preserving a tidy home between deep cleans up.

Q: How often should I clean the filters and brushes?A: It is suggested to clean the filters and brushes after every few uses to ensure optimal efficiency. Speak with the user handbook for specific maintenance guidelines.

Q: Can robotic vacuums navigate stairs?A: Most robotic vacuums are geared up with cliff sensing units that avoid them from dropping stairs. Nevertheless, they are not created to clean stairs.

Q: Are robotic vacuums noisy?A: Generally, robotic vacuums are quieter than traditional vacuums. However, sound levels can differ by model. Some designs use peaceful cleaning modes for nighttime usage.

Q: Can I utilize a robotic vacuum with animals?A: Yes, many robotic vacuums are developed to deal with pet hair and dander. Try to find models with strong suction and specialized pet cleaning functions.
